Method
Preparing Chicken Tenders
- 1
Prep the Chicken
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Slice the chicken breasts into strips.
- 2
Breading Process
Set up a breading station: place flour in a shallow bowl, beat the eggs in a second bowl, and place panko breadcrumbs mixed with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and paprika in a third bowl.
- 3
Coat the Chicken
Dip each chicken strip first in flour, then in the egg, and finally coat with panko breadcrumbs. Place on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
- 4
Bake
Drizzle olive oil over the breaded chicken strips and b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until golden and crispy.

Cooking Rainbow Carrots
- 6
Roast the Carrots
Toss the sliced rainbow carrots with olive oil and salt. Spread them out on a baking sheet and roast in the oven for 15-20 minutes, or until tender.
